Output 65956f528a476fba30afcf272726bbfebd53f28ee580d93d39c3b96c034baa5a:26

value
2665813
script pubkey
OP_0 OP_PUSHBYTES_20 e49c23beb3da9ddb5d58e6fda7a77e41aaed7c3a
address
bc1qujwz804nm2wakh2cum760fm7gx4w6lp6869dyh
transaction
65956f528a476fba30afcf272726bbfebd53f28ee580d93d39c3b96c034baa5a